1+104TH GENERAL ASSEMBLY State of Illinois 2025 and 2026 HB1120 Introduced , by Rep. Kevin Schmidt SYNOPSIS AS INTRODUCED: 625 ILCS 5/6-110 Amends the Illinois Vehicle Code. Removes a provision that requires the Secretary of State to designate on each driver's license issued a space where the licensee may indicate his blood type and RH factor. 311 1 AN ACT concerning transportation.
412 2 Be it enacted by the People of the State of Illinois,
513 3 represented in the General Assembly:
614 4 Section 5. The Illinois Vehicle Code is amended by
715 5 changing Section 6-110 as follows:
816 6 (625 ILCS 5/6-110)
917 7 Sec. 6-110. Licenses issued to drivers.
1018 8 (a) The Secretary of State shall issue to every qualifying
1119 9 applicant a driver's license as applied for, which license
1220 10 shall bear a distinguishing number assigned to the licensee,
1321 11 the legal name, signature, zip code, date of birth, residence
1422 12 address, and a brief description of the licensee.
1523 13 Licenses issued shall also indicate the classification and
1624 14 the restrictions under Section 6-104 of this Code. The
1725 15 Secretary may adopt rules to establish informational
1826 16 restrictions that can be placed on the driver's license
1927 17 regarding specific conditions of the licensee.
2028 18 A driver's license issued may, in the discretion of the
2129 19 Secretary, include a suitable photograph of a type prescribed
2230 20 by the Secretary.
2331 21 (a-1) If the licensee is less than 18 years of age, unless
2432 22 one of the exceptions in subsection (a-2) apply, the license
2533 23 shall, as a matter of law, be invalid for the operation of any

3468 1 motor vehicle during the following times:
3569 2 (A) Between 11:00 p.m. Friday and 6:00 a.m. Saturday;
3670 3 (B) Between 11:00 p.m. Saturday and 6:00 a.m. on
3771 4 Sunday; and
3872 5 (C) Between 10:00 p.m. on Sunday to Thursday,
3973 6 inclusive, and 6:00 a.m. on the following day.
4074 7 (a-2) The driver's license of a person under the age of 18
4175 8 shall not be invalid as described in subsection (a-1) of this
4276 9 Section if the licensee under the age of 18 was:
4377 10 (1) accompanied by the licensee's parent or guardian
4478 11 or other person in custody or control of the minor;
4579 12 (2) on an errand at the direction of the minor's
4680 13 parent or guardian, without any detour or stop;
4781 14 (3) in a motor vehicle involved in interstate travel;
4882 15 (4) going to or returning home from an employment
4983 16 activity, without any detour or stop;
5084 17 (5) involved in an emergency;
5185 18 (6) going to or returning home from, without any
5286 19 detour or stop, an official school, religious, or other
5387 20 recreational activity supervised by adults and sponsored
5488 21 by a government or governmental agency, a civic
5589 22 organization, or another similar entity that takes
5690 23 responsibility for the licensee, without any detour or
5791 24 stop;
5892 25 (7) exercising First Amendment rights protected by the
5993 26 United States Constitution, such as the free exercise of

70104 1 religion, freedom of speech, and the right of assembly; or
71105 2 (8) married or had been married or is an emancipated
72106 3 minor under the Emancipation of Minors Act.
73107 4 (a-2.5) The driver's license of a person who is 17 years of
74108 5 age and has been licensed for at least 12 months is not invalid
75109 6 as described in subsection (a-1) of this Section while the
76110 7 licensee is participating as an assigned driver in a Safe
77111 8 Rides program that meets the following criteria:
78112 9 (1) the program is sponsored by the Boy Scouts of
79113 10 America or another national public service organization;
80114 11 and
81115 12 (2) the sponsoring organization carries liability
82116 13 insurance covering the program.
83117 14 (a-3) If a graduated driver's license holder over the age
84118 15 of 18 committed an offense against traffic regulations
85119 16 governing the movement of vehicles or any violation of Section
86120 17 6-107 or Section 12-603.1 of this Code in the 6 months prior to
87121 18 the graduated driver's license holder's 18th birthday, and was
88122 19 subsequently convicted of the offense, the provisions of
89123 20 subsection (a-1) shall continue to apply until such time as a
90124 21 period of 6 consecutive months has elapsed without an
91125 22 additional violation and subsequent conviction of an offense
92126 23 against traffic regulations governing the movement of vehicles
93127 24 or Section 6-107 or Section 12-603.1 of this Code.
94128 25 (a-4) If an applicant for a driver's license or
95129 26 instruction permit has a current identification card issued by
